TAG Honda unveil 2021 British Superbike livery ahead of testing

Dan Linfoot and TAG Honda showcase the first images of 🎶their new CBR1000RR-R bike ahead of the o🐽pening pre-season test at Silverstone.
Linꩲfoot joins Honda following a 2020 season that saw him♛ finish tenth for BMW in the Pirelli National Superstock 1000 championship.
The move to Hon🦄da also means a return to British Superbike for Linfoot who’s last full season came with Santander Yamaha in 2019.
Linfoot added: "I am really exci🦹ted to get back on the bike this week, being back in superbike with TAG Honda is a really exciting time for us all꧑, with the support from Honda UK we are all chomping at the bit to get started.
"The bike looks incredible - I have not rౠidden the new model Fireblade yet, but I am very keen to get started on Wednesday a𒅌t Silverstone.
"I’d just like to take this chanc🎀e to thank TAG for such a big effort with this season’s bi🔴ke, I have a great feeling about this year."
2020 was one of Honda's better BSB seasons of la♌te, as they claimed four wins in total throu🍸gh Glenn and Andrew Irwin.
The 2021 season sees Japanese duo Takumi Takahashi and Ryo Mizuno added at Ho൲nda Racing alongside Glenn Irwin, while Linfoot will make up the f💝ourth Honda on the grid.
The first of four pre-s♊eason tests begins tomorrow at Silverstone before heading to Snetterton (both behind closed doo🤪rs). Oulton Park and Donington Park will then conclude the test schedule on May 19 and June 8, before the season opener on June 25-27.
